Output e4ecbceaa43c34c1f0966ada92902debaad1204cb91eab23d3711308de90583a:1

value
3853680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e484988e9aa25bcafe60a81798918fea18d4f5d OP_EQUALVERIFY OP_CHECKSIG
address
188vJZytCwHNjk3TRLzzYmPfZiiDh4T6tM
transaction
e4ecbceaa43c34c1f0966ada92902debaad1204cb91eab23d3711308de90583a
spent
true